Package | Description |
---|---|
it.uniroma2.art.owlart.models | |
it.uniroma2.art.owlart.models.impl | |
it.uniroma2.art.owlart.utilities |
Modifier and Type | Method and Description |
---|---|
ARTResourceIterator |
SKOSXLModel.getRelatedLabels(ARTResource xLabel,
ARTResource... graphs)
since
skosxl:labelRelation property represents an extension point and is not thought to be
instantiated its way, if available a reasoner is set by default |
ARTResourceIterator |
SKOSXLModel.listAltXLabels(ARTURIResource skosConcept,
ARTResource... graphs)
list all Alternative XLabels for concept
skosConcept |
ARTResourceIterator |
SKOSXLModel.listAltXLabels(ARTURIResource skosConcept,
String languageTag,
ARTResource... graphs)
list all Alternative XLabels for concept
skosConcept with language given by
languageTag |
ARTResourceIterator |
RDFSModel.listClasses(boolean inferred,
ARTResource... graphs)
list all the classes in the current Model (in graphs:
graphs ). |
ARTResourceIterator |
DirectReasoning.listDirectInstances(ARTResource type,
ARTResource... graphs)
Retrieves all the direct instances of a given class
|
ARTResourceIterator |
DirectReasoning.listDirectSubClasses(ARTResource resource,
ARTResource... graphs)
returns a list of direct subclasses of
resource |
ARTResourceIterator |
DirectReasoning.listDirectSuperClasses(ARTResource resource,
ARTResource... graphs) |
ARTResourceIterator |
DirectReasoning.listDirectTypes(ARTResource res,
ARTResource... graphs)
retrieves all the classes which are direct types for resource
res |
ARTResourceIterator |
SKOSXLModel.listHiddenXLabels(ARTURIResource skosConcept,
ARTResource... graphs)
list all Hidden XLabels for concept
skosConcept |
ARTResourceIterator |
SKOSXLModel.listHiddenXLabels(ARTURIResource skosConcept,
String languageTag,
ARTResource... graphs)
list all Hidden XLabels for concept
skosConcept with language given by
languageTag |
ARTResourceIterator |
RDFModel.listInstances(ARTResource type,
boolean inferred,
ARTResource... graphs)
retrieves all instances of class
type |
ARTResourceIterator |
BaseRDFTripleModel.listNamedGraphs()
returns an
ARTResourceIterator over the namedgraphs declared in the global RDF graph |
ARTResourceIterator |
SKOSXLModel.listPrefXLabels(ARTURIResource skosConcept,
ARTResource... graphs)
returns the preferred XLabels (in all available languages) for concept
skosConcept SKOS requires that only one preferred label value is provided for a single concept for each language |
ARTResourceIterator |
RDFSModel.listPropertyDomains(ARTResource property,
boolean inferred,
ARTResource... graphs)
returns all the classes which have been declared in the domain of the property
|
ARTResourceIterator |
RDFSModel.listPropertyRanges(ARTResource property,
boolean inferred,
ARTResource... graphs)
as
getPropertyRanges(property, false) |
ARTResourceIterator |
RDFSModel.listSubClasses(ARTResource cls,
boolean inferred,
ARTResource... graphs)
returns all subclasses (also non direct ones) of class
cls |
ARTResourceIterator |
BaseRDFTripleModel.listSubjectsOfPredObjPair(ARTURIResource predicate,
ARTNode object,
boolean inferred,
ARTResource... graphs)
list all resources which appear as subjects of statements having given
predicate and
object |
ARTResourceIterator |
RDFSModel.listSuperClasses(ARTResource cls,
boolean inferred,
ARTResource... graphs)
returns all superclasses (also non direct ones) of class
cls |
ARTResourceIterator |
RDFModel.listTypes(ARTResource res,
boolean inferred,
ARTResource... graphs)
retrieves all classes which are types for resource
res |
ARTResourceIterator |
OWLModel.listValuesOfSubjObjPropertyPair(ARTResource individual,
ARTURIResource property,
boolean inferred,
ARTResource... graphs)
returns an iterator over the list of values bound to individual
individual through object
property property both parameters need to be instantiated |
Modifier and Type | Class and Description |
---|---|
protected class |
OWLModelImpl.ARTResourceIteratorImpl |
class |
ResourceIteratorFilteringNodeIterator
retrieves only those nodes which are resources
|
class |
ResourceIteratorWrappingNodeIterator
An adapter class between Node and Resource Iterators.
|
protected class |
SKOSXLModelImpl.LanguageFilteredXLabelIterator |
class |
SubjectsOfStatementsIterator
an wrapping iterator class which extracts subjects from statement iterators
|
Modifier and Type | Method and Description |
---|---|
ARTResourceIterator |
SKOSXLModelImpl.getRelatedLabels(ARTResource xLabel,
ARTResource... graphs) |
ARTResourceIterator |
SKOSXLModelImpl.listAltXLabels(ARTURIResource skosConcept,
ARTResource... graphs) |
ARTResourceIterator |
SKOSXLModelImpl.listAltXLabels(ARTURIResource skosConcept,
String languageTag,
ARTResource... graphs) |
ARTResourceIterator |
RDFSModelImpl.listClasses(bo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
OWLModelImpl.listClasses(bo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
SKOSXLModelImpl.listHiddenXLabels(ARTURIResource skosConcept,
ARTResource... graphs) |
ARTResourceIterator |
SKOSXLModelImpl.listHiddenXLabels(ARTURIResource skosConcept,
String languageTag,
ARTResource... graphs) |
ARTResourceIterator |
RDFModelImpl.listInstances(ARTResource res,
boolean inferred,
ARTResource... graphs) |
protected ARTResourceIterator |
OWLModelImpl.listInversePropertyBoundConcepts(ARTResource resource,
ARTURIResource property,
ARTURIResource inverseProperty,
boolean inferred,
ARTResource... graphs)
method which is invoked by this OWLModel implementation when the complete set of results from a
property which has an inverse has to be obtained.
|
ARTResourceIterator |
SPARQLBasedRDFTripleModelImpl.listNamedGraphs() |
ARTResourceIterator |
RDFModelImpl.listNamedGraphs() |
ARTResourceIterator |
SKOSXLModelImpl.listPrefXLabels(ARTURIResource skosConcept,
ARTResource... graphs) |
ARTResourceIterator |
RDFSModelImpl.listPropertyDomains(ARTResource property,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
RDFSModelImpl.listPropertyRanges(ARTResource property,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
RDFSModelImpl.listSubClasses(ARTResource cls,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
RDFModelImpl.listSubjectsOfPredObjPair(ARTURIResource predicate,
ARTNode object,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
BaseRDFModelImpl.listSubjectsOfPredObjPair(ARTURIResource property,
ARTNode object,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
RDFSModelImpl.listSuperClasses(ARTResource cls,
boolean inferred,
ARTResource... graphs) |
protected ARTResourceIterator |
OWLModelImpl.listSymmetricPropertyBoundConcepts(ARTResource resource,
ARTURIResource property,
boolean inferred,
ARTResource... graphs)
method which is invoked by this OWLModel implementation when the complete set of results from a
property which is symmetric has to be obtained.
|
protected ARTResourceIterator |
OWLModelImpl.listTransitiveInversePropertyBoundConcepts(ARTResource resource,
ARTURIResource nonTransitiveProperty,
ARTURIResource nonTransitiveInverseProperty,
ARTURIResource transitiveExtensionProperty,
ARTURIResource transitiveExtensionInverseProperty,
boolean inferred,
ARTResource... graphs) |
protected ARTResourceIterator |
OWLModelImpl.listTransitivePropertyBoundConcepts(ARTResource resource,
ARTURIResource nonTransitiveProperty,
ARTURIResource transitiveExtensionProperty,
boolean inferred,
ARTResource... graphs)
|
protected ARTResourceIterator |
OWLModelImpl.listTransitivePropertyBoundConcepts(ARTResource resource,
ARTURIResource property,
boolean inferred,
ARTResource... graphs)
method which is invoked by this OWLModel implementation when the complete set of results from a
transitive property has to be obtained.
|
ARTResourceIterator |
RDFModelImpl.listTypes(ARTResource res,
boolean inferred,
ARTResource... graphs) |
ARTResourceIterator |
OWLModelImpl.listValuesOfSubjObjPropertyPair(ARTResource individual,
ARTURIResource property,
boolean inferred,
ARTResource... contexts) |
Constructor and Description |
---|
NamedInstancesIteratorFilteringResourceIterator(ARTResourceIterator resIt,
RDFModel model) |
URIResourceIteratorFilteringResourceIterator(ARTResourceIterator resIt) |
URIResourceIteratorWrappingResourceIterator(ARTResourceIterator resIt) |
Modifier and Type | Method and Description |
---|---|
static ARTResourceIterator |
RDFIterators.createARTResourceIterator(RDFIterator<ARTResource> it) |
static ARTResourceIterator |
RDFIterators.filterResources(ARTNodeIterator it)
this filtered iterator passes only
ARTResource s out of a generic ARTNodeIterator |
static ARTResourceIterator |
RDFIterators.listDistinct(ARTResourceIterator it)
returns an iterator with removed duplicates from
it |
static ARTResourceIterator |
RDFIterators.listSubjects(ARTStatementIterator statIt) |
static ARTResourceIterator |
RDFIterators.toResourceIterator(ARTNodeIterator it)
This is to be used if the developer knows in advance that wrapped iterator contains only Resources.
|
Modifier and Type | Method and Description |
---|---|
static ARTURIResourceIterator |
RDFIterators.filterURIs(ARTResourceIterator it)
this filtered iterator passes only
ARTURIResource s out of a generic ARTResourceIterator |
static ARTResourceIterator |
RDFIterators.listDistinct(ARTResourceIterator it)
returns an iterator with removed duplicates from
it |
static ARTURIResourceIterator |
RDFIterators.toURIResourceIterator(ARTResourceIterator it)
This is to be used if the developer knows in advance that wrapped iterator contains only URIs.
|
Copyright © 2015 ART Group, University of Rome, Tor Vergata. All Rights Reserved.